    Today on episode 31 we will be speaking to Retha Charette from The Roaming Nanny.   BIO: Retha the Roaming Nanny is an Adventuress based out of Vermont, USA. She has traveled to 5 continents and 48 U.S. States. Her favorite experiences, so far, have been summiting Mount Kilimanjaro, snorkeling in the Galapagos Islands, seeing the Temples at Abu Simbel in Egypt, doing the Plank Walk in the Sky outside of Xi’an China, and hiking the Salkantay Trek to Machu Picchu.    WHAT YOU WILL GAIN FROM LISTENING TO THIS PODCAST: New outlook on tough situations - Retha took big change, like her divorce, and instead of letting it hinder her she found the silver lining in it and allowed it to lead her on to a path of adventure. The motivation to attempt something out of your comfort zone. Retha shares her climb up Kilimanjaro that she signed herself up for without any real prior training.   • Ep. 18 The Business Of Adventure

    18/06/2018 Duration: 01h09min

    Cathy O'Dowd is a South African mountaineer and motivational speaker, who now lives in Andorra in southern Europe. She is best known as the first woman in the world to climb Everest from both sides. She turned those climbs into a 20+ year self-employed career as an international motivational speaker (paid talks in 44 countries, so far). And that in turns leaves her with a lot of free time to pursue her passions for mountains - climbing and skiing.   As a side project, she now runs a website The Business of Adventure, to help younger adventurers get practical about how they can build their brand, fund their projects, and monetize their achievements.   She is passionate about encouraging people to take the leap into the unconventional career or lifestyle while being pragmatic about the work involved in making that a financially successful choice.    WE COVER: The launch of her career as the first South African to climb Everest from both sides.   • Ep.14 Meet The Worlds Longest Honeymooners: Honey Trek

    21/05/2018 Duration: 01h06min

    Mike and Anne Howard left on their honeymoon in January 2012 and have been exploring the globe ever since. They realized life is short, the world is big, and the value of travel too great to wait until retirement, so to kick off their marriage they decided to take a trip around the world…on what has become “The World’s Longest Honeymoon.” Using Anne’s background as a national magazine editor and Mike’s as a digital marketer and photographer, they created HoneyTrek.com to chronicle their journey to over 50 countries and show more people how to mobilize their travel dreams. Having reviewed over 200 luxury hotels and excursions across seven continents, they know the five-star side of travel, though they also understand how to get to the heart of local culture. They've taught English in tribal Vietnam, housesat in Costa Rica, ridden local mini-buses across East Africa, and learned variety is the spice of life and travel.
